Thrilla in Westminsta! Terriers defeat Cosmos

The Terriers and Cosmos were locked in a classic battle between two teams reaching their mid season form. Reminiscent of the historic rivalry that saw sold out gymnasiums for many years the two teams battled to the very end, with BF coming out on top 58-55.

“What a game, what a crowd,” said Head Coach Evan Chadwick. “Springfield is not a 1-6 team, they are physical, skilled and well coached. No one should sleep on them the second half of the season.”

Bellows Falls would take a 6 point lead into halftime. The Cosmos responded in the third, outscoring the Terriers by 9 and at the buzzer, an NBA range 3, gave the Cosmos their first lead of the contest.

The final 8 minutes were full of swings, with neither team gaining any meaningful seperation.

Jamison Nystrom (12 points) was simply sensational in the fourth, diving on a loose ball, hitting several pull-ups and adding 3 free throws. Jake Moore (12 points) battled the bigger Cosmos all night and added a clutch floater in the fourth to keep BF ahead.

“Jake and Jamio played like captains tonight,” said Chadwick.

The Terriers extended their lead to as many as 8 with 3 minutes remaining, but the Cosmos would not go quietly, as their press generated several turnovers to narrow the lead to as little as 2.

Walker James proved clutch in the final minute, hitting 2 free throws to extend the lead back to 4 and the Cosmos were unable to hit a desperation shot as time expired.

BF has now run off 3 straight wins and jumps above the .500 mark at 4-3.
